程序设计20231311课程 计算机
javaweb系统如何设计
设计一个完整可运行的JavaWeb系统可以分为以下几个步骤: 项目需求分析和设计:首先,对于要开发的系统进行全面的需求分析,了解系统的功能和特点,明确用户的需求和期望,并根据需求确定系统的架构和设计。 数据库设计:根据需求分析的结果,设计系统所需的数据库结构,包括表的字段、数据类型、主键、外键等。 ......
【Java】个人项目互评——中小学数学卷子自动生成程序
目 录 一、简介 二、项目要求 三、测试与分析 1、功能测试 2、代码分析 四、项目总结 1、代码优点 2、代码缺点 五、结语 一、简介 本博客用于分析和总结我的结对编程队友王晓婧的个人项目代码,代码使用语言为Java,与本人项目所用编程语言一致。在分析王晓婧同学代码的优缺点的同时,我也同时发现了自 ......
acwing 294 计算重复
原题 首先\(conn(conn(s_2,n_2),m) = conn(s_2,n_2 \times m)\),因此我们可以找一个最大的\(m'\)满足\(conn(s_2, m')\)能由\(conn(s_1, n1)\)生成,然后再通过\(m = \lfloor \frac{m'}{n_2} \ ......
计算日期
输入一个日期startdate(年、月、日)和天数days(>=1),输出自该输入日期days天后的日期enddate(即edate=startdate+days)。要求输入和输出的年份为四位整数,输入时要对输入数据的有效性进行检查,并确保得到有效的输入数据。同时需耍考虑跨月、跨年和闰年等情况,闰年 ......
HNU个人项目互评(中小学数学卷子自动生成程序)
一. 项目简介 本次项目为设计一个中小学数学卷子的自动生成程序,本文为对我的结对编程对象lhq同学的个人项目进行评价与建议。 二.项目结构 先来看看项目的构成: 如同类名所示,各个类各司其职。 具体来说: main类中负责用户的登录和切换出题难度 Makeallquestion 接口中包含了一个方法 ......
HNU个人项目互评:中小学数学卷子自动生成程序
HNU个人项目互评:中小学数学卷子自动生成程序 项目名称:中小学数学卷子自动生成程序 结对成员:杨安然、朱志星 项目作者:杨安然 编程语言:JAVA 博客作者:朱志星 目录 一、前言 二、项目要求 三、黑盒测试 四、代码评价 五、整体评价 一、前言 上一周本结对小组成员双方各自完成了中小学数学卷子自 ......
salesforce零基础学习(一百三十一)Validation 一次的bypass设计
本篇参考: https://admin.salesforce.com/blog/2022/how-i-solved-it-bypass-validation-rules-in-flows 背景:作为系统的全局考虑,我们在设计validation rule / flow / trigger时,往往会使 ......
个人项目互评及功能代码分析:中小学数学卷子自动生成程序
代码作者:桑健康 评价人:李明胜 项目语言:Java 一、项目需求: 用户: 小学、初中和高中数学老师。 功能: 1、命令行输入用户名和密码,两者之间用空格隔开(程序预设小学、初中和高中各三个账号,具体见附表),如果用户名和密码都正确,将根据账户类型显示“当前选择为XX出题”,XX为小学、初中和高中 ......
【HNU个人项目互评】 基于java生成中小学数学卷子自动生成程序代码分析
【评价者】:金颖希 【项目作者】:刘一凡 【使用语言】:Java 前言 【项目简介】本项目为中小学数学卷子自动生成程序,采用java编程语言实现用户登录、用户类型判断、生成题目、题目查重、切换用户类型以及题目保存等简单功能。 【评价标准】本文以代码分析为主,主要从代码的可读性、性能、可靠性、可扩展性 ......
使用Avalonia创建IOS应用程序
1. 首先你需要有一台mac,安装好xcode,Visual Studio For Mac或者Rider 2. 使用如下指令安装Avalonia模板: dotnet new install "Avalonia.Templates" 3. 新建一个空目录,使用命令行命令进入这个目录,然后使用如下命令创 ......
软件工程(论文查查程序)
这个作业属于哪个课程 (https://edu.cnblogs.com/campus/jmu/ComputerScience21/) 这个作业要求在哪里 (https://edu.cnblogs.com/campus/jmu/ComputerScience21/homework/13034) 这个作 ......
计算机组成原理
计算机组成原理 计算机硬件 一些物理装置按系统结构的要求构成一个有机整体为计算机软件运行提供物质基础 计算机硬件组成 CPU 主板 内存 电源、主机箱 硬盘 显卡 键盘、鼠标 显示器 等.... 装机 最简单的计算机组成 CPU Memory(内存) Motherboard(主板) IO设备 冯.诺 ......
微信小程序跳转腾讯会议小程序
// pages/sub-preMeeting/join-meeting/join-meeting?scene=m%3D + 会议号 中间不要带空格 // 示例 pages/sub-preMeeting/join-meeting/join-meeting?scene=m%3D112233445 un ......
个人项目互评(中小学数学卷子自动生成程序)
一、项目需求: 用户: 小学、初中和高中数学老师。 功能: 1、命令行输入用户名和密码,两者之间用空格隔开(程序预设小学、初中和高中各三个账号,具体见附表),如果用户名和密码都正确,将根据账户类型显示“当前选择为XX出题”,XX为小学、初中和高中三个选项中的一个。否则提示“请输入正确的用户名、密码” ......
软件设计模式系列之十——组合模式
组合模式是一种结构型设计模式,用于将对象组合成树形结构以表示部分-整体层次结构。这个模式允许客户端以一致的方式处理单个对象和对象组合,因此它将单个对象和组合对象视为可互换的。
组合模式允许你将对象组合成树状结构来表示"部分-整体"的层次结构。组合模式使得客户端可以统一地处理单个对象和组合对象,无需关... ......
工程概论作业二——个人项目《论文查重程序(JAVA实现)》
工程概论作业二——个人项目《论文查重程序(JAVA实现)》 GitHub仓库 工程概论 计算2112 这个作业要求在哪里 工程概论作业二 这个作业的目标 熟悉GitHub的使用,编写程序实现论文查重,了解个人软件开发流程。 psp表格 | PSP2.1 Personal Software Proce ......
小白之创建第一个java程序
(1)下载JDK运行环境。步骤:进入oracle官网 products Hardware and Software java download java 傻瓜式安装,注意安装路径尽量不在C盘 (2) 用记事本写java代码 文件名HelloWord.java,注意文件名和类名要一致 (3)DOS命令 ......
代码混淆工具ipaguard:如何使用ipaguard保护和混淆iOS应用程序代码
转载:怎么保护苹果手机移动应用程序ios ipa文件中的代码? 目录 转载:怎么保护苹果手机移动应用程序ios ipa文件中的代码? 代码混淆步骤 1. 选择要混淆保护的ipa文件 2. 选择要混淆的类名称 3. 选择要混淆保护的函数,方法 4. 配置签名证书 5. 混淆和测试运行 编辑 在当 ......
设计模式之单例模式
单例模式是一种创建型设计模式,它确保一个类只有一个实例,并提供一个全局访问点。 在Java中,实现单例模式有多种方式,以下是其中两种常见的实现方式: 饿汉式单例模式(Eager Initialization): 在类加载时就创建实例,并且该实例在整个程序生命周期内都是唯一的。 public clas ......
反编译python程序
1. 工具 1. pyinstxtractor.py 2. uncompyle6 : pip install uncompyle6 2.安装pyinstaller pip install pyinstaller 3. exe 解 pyc python pyinstxtractor.py xxx.ex ......
小程序怎么隐藏view
小程序怎么隐藏view 一、使用wx:if指令 <view wx:if="{{3>2}}">我是wx:if</view> 二、使用opacity属性 <view style="opacity:{{opacity}}">我是opacity属性</view> 三、使用display属性 <view st ......
Qt程序框架的运行机制
Qt程序框架 程序入口 当我们新建一个Qt Widget工程的时候,会自动生成四个文件: main.cpp widget.h widget.cpp widget.ui 其中main.cpp是整个程序的入口,文件中只有一个简单的main()函数。 #include "widget.h" #includ ......
符号计算辅助密码学
例题 BUU - DASbook - happy # 以下四行 已知 c=0x7a7e031f14f6b6c3292d11a41161d2491ce8bcdc67ef1baa9e e=0x872a335 #q + q*p^3 =128536731745208998078944182958039785 ......
侯捷C++高级面向对象编程_下_课程笔记
friend(友元):相同Class的各个objects互为friends(友元) class complex{ public: complex (double r = 0, double I = 0) : re (r), im (i) { } //一个对象的成员函数可以调用另一个对象的私有成员变量 ......
EMC设计经验谈
http://csdzxx.smehn.cn/News/Detail?id=191008 9. 元器件布局与布线中的电磁兼容设计: 对于开关电源设备内部元器件的布局必须整体考虑电磁兼容性的要求,设备内部的干扰源会通过辐射和串扰等途径影响其它元件或部件的工作,研究表明,在离干扰源一定距离时,干扰源的能 ......
HNU_个人项目_中小学数学卷子自动生成程序_简要分析何梁雨代码
一、前言 感谢老师安排的这一次互评,以及我的结对编程伙伴何梁雨。在互评中我学到了不一样的编程思路,更清晰的感受到了自己编程水平哪一部分存在缺陷,并向这个方向学习改正。 二、测试与评价 1.测试程序运行 (1)界面整洁简单,流程清晰。动作转折的地方经常会有一长串横杠隔开,让用户更容易理解,体验感好。且 ......
工程概论个人作业二---《论文查重程序设计》
工程概论作业二 《论文查重程序设计》 本次项目的Github链接如下:https://github.com/Tjdtec/Tjdtec/tree/main/202121331042 作业要求 这个作业属于哪个课程 工程概论 这个作业要求在哪里 作业要求 这个作业的目标 构建完整的项目流程,体验测试环 ......
【个人项目互评】————中小学生题目生成程序
在完成个人项目的建设后,我和搭档互相交换了代码进行分析。在阅读过程中,看到了她代码的优势,也同时看到了自己代码的不足。再次写下这一次的项目分析; 一、题目要求 二、测试与分析 功能完成情况: 在输入正确的账户名以及密码后,能够获得当前用户年级信息以及后续操作步骤,引导功能完善; 在输入“-1”进行退 ......
视频存储平台EasyCVR视频关于机电设别可视化管理可实施设计方案
EasyCVR视频存储平台的机电设备可视化管理方案,通过集成视频采集、数据处理和可视化管理三个模块,实现了对机电设备的全方位、实时监控和管理,大大提高了设备的运行效率和使用安全性。 一、EasyCVR平台部署: 在需要监控的机电设备周围安装EasyCVR定制的4G车载摄像头,并通过OBD采集设备获取 ......